Choose the Right Electric Bike for City Commuting
If you’re looking for a convenient and eco-friendly way to navigate the busy streets of the city, an electric commuter bike can be the perfect solution. With their electric motors, these bikes provide an effortless and enjoyable riding experience, making your daily commute a breeze.
When it comes to choosing the right electric bike for city commuting, there are a few key factors to consider. First and foremost, you’ll want to think about the range of the bike. The range refers to how far the bike can travel on a single charge. For city commuting, a range of 40-60 miles should be more than sufficient.
Next, consider the motor power. The motor is what provides the electric assist, helping you pedal with ease. Look for a bike with a motor power of at least 250 watts, as this will ensure a smooth and efficient ride. Additionally, consider whether you want a pedal-assist or throttle-operated bike. Pedal-assist bikes provide assistance when you pedal, while throttle-operated bikes have a throttle that allows you to control the motor without pedaling.
Another important factor to consider is the bike’s weight and portability. Since you’ll be riding in the city, you’ll likely need to carry your bike up stairs or store it in a small apartment. Look for a bike that is lightweight and easy to handle, as this will make your daily commute much more manageable.
Lastly, don’t forget about the overall comfort and design of the bike. Look for a commuter bike with a comfortable seat, adjustable handlebars, and good suspension. Additionally, consider the bike’s aesthetics and choose one that suits your personal style and preferences.
Overall, finding the right electric bike for city commuting is all about considering your specific needs and preferences. By taking into account factors such as range, motor power, weight, and comfort, you’ll be able to choose the perfect electric bike that will make your daily commute a breeze.

How to Maintain and Take Care of Your Electric Commuter Bike
Electric bikes have become increasingly popular for city commuting, offering a convenient and eco-friendly alternative to traditional bicycles. To keep your electric commuter bike in top shape and ensure a smooth ride, regular maintenance and care are essential. Here are some tips to help you maintain your e-bike:
- Keep it clean: Regularly clean your electric commuter bike to remove dirt, dust, and grime that can accumulate during rides. Use a mild soap and water solution and a soft cloth to wipe down the frame, handlebars, and other components. Avoid using high-pressure water or abrasive cleaners that can damage the electrical components.
- Check the tires: Regularly inspect the tires for any signs of wear or damage. Ensure they are properly inflated to the recommended pressure to optimize performance and extend their lifespan. Replace worn-out tires promptly to maintain good traction and stability.
- Inspect the brakes: Regularly check the brake pads for signs of wear. Replace them if they are worn out to ensure reliable and responsive braking. Also, check the brake cables and adjust them if necessary to maintain proper brake performance.
- Monitor the battery: Keep an eye on the battery level and recharge it regularly. Avoid letting it completely drain as this can shorten its lifespan. When storing your electric commuter bike for an extended period, remove the battery and store it in a cool and dry place. Foll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for battery maintenance and charging.
- Check the chain and drivetrain: Clean and lubricate the chain regularly to prevent rust and ensure smooth shifting. Inspect the chain for signs of wear and replace it if necessary. Also, check the gears and derailleurs for proper alignment and make any necessary adjustments.
- Keep it protected: When not in use, store your electric commuter bike in a dry and secure location. Use a bike cover to protect it from dust, moisture, and UV rays. Consider using a lock or alarm system to deter theft.
- Regular servicing: Schedule regular servicing with a professional bike mechanic to ensure that all components are properly adjusted and maintained. They can identify any potential issues and make necessary repairs to keep your electric commuter bike in optimal condition.
By following these maintenance tips, you can ensure that your electric commuter bike remains in excellent condition for your daily rides. Remember, a well-maintained e-bike not only provides a comfortable and enjoyable commuting experience but also prolongs its lifespan. Happy riding!

How to Choose an Electric Bike for Your Urban Commute
When it comes to commuting in the city, an electric bike is a fantastic option. With the rise in popularity of e-bikes, there are now many different models to choose from. Here are some factors to consider when selecting the best electric bike for your urban commute:
1. Range
One of the most important factors to consider is the range of the electric bike. Make sure to choose a bike with a range that will comfortably cover your daily commute. Factors such as your weight, the terrain, and whether you plan to use pedal-assist or throttle-mode will all affect the range of the bike.
2. Battery
Another important consideration is the battery of the electric bike. Look for a bike with a high-quality battery that will provide reliable power and has a long lifespan. Lithium-ion batteries are commonly used in e-bikes and are known for their durability and longevity.
Additionally, consider the battery’s charging time. Opt for a bike with a quick charging time, so you can easily recharge the battery at home or at the office during your workday.
3. Motor
The motor is the heart of an electric bike and plays a significant role in its overall performance. There are two main types of motors: hub motors and mid-drive motors.
Hub motors are located in the wheels and provide direct power to them. They are known for their simplicity and ease of use. Mid-drive motors, on the other hand, are located near the bike’s pedals and provide power through the chain. They offer better weight distribution and a more natural riding experience.
Consider your personal preferences and the type of terrain you’ll encounter on your urban commute when choosing between a hub motor and a mid-drive motor.
Remember to also check the motor’s power. Choose a bike with a motor that has sufficient power to handle your daily commute with ease.
In conclusion, when selecting an electric bike for your urban commute, consider factors such as range, battery, and motor. Finding the right e-bike will make your daily commute more enjoyable and efficient.
